PMMSY for Women
The Pradhan Mantri Matsya Sampada Yojana (PMMSY) implemented by the Department of Fisheries, Ministry of Fisheries, Animal Husbandry and Dairying, Government of India encompasses inclusive development by providing higher financial assistance of 60 percent of the unit cost for women beneficiaries under beneficiary-oriented activities. Further, under the Entrepreneur Model of PMMSY, women are supported with financial assistance up to 60% of the total project cost, with a ceiling limit of Rs. 1.50 crore per project. To promote women’s participation in the fisheries sector, PMMSY supports women beneficiaries across a range of activities including fish farming, hatcheries, seaweed farming, bivalve cultivation, ornamental fisheries, fish processing, and marketing. Training and capacity-building programs have been imparted to women beneficiaries under PMMSY, including initiatives for entrepreneurship, skill development, and livelihood generation and start-ups.
Under the PMMSY, during the last five Financial Years (2020-21 to 2024-25), fisheries development proposals amounting to Rs. 4061.96 crore with central share of Rs. 1534.46 crore have been sanctioned for covering a total 99,018 women beneficiaries across various States and UTs. The Government of Maharashtra has reported that the State Government has taken various initiatives to promote women’s participation in fisheries sector which includes (i) Awareness programmes, workshops, camps, Government at doorstep, exhibitions, (ii) Outreach programmes, publicity through banners/flex at block level, (iii) Training programmes regarding implementation of various components related to fish culture, (iv) Advertisement published in newspaper for promotion of Pradhan Mantri Matsya Sampada Yojana scheme and (v) Issuance of information through pamphlets, brochures, leaflets regarding the publicity and promotion of schemes. The State Government has further reported that in order to run the PMMSY scheme smoothly and efficiently, training programmes are conducted at District level and a total of 112 training programmes including 17 training programmes in Palghar District were conducted with Women’s participation in the State. The Government of Maharashtra has reported that financial assistance of Rs. 401.25 crore to promote women’s participation in fisheries has been sanctioned and released a sum of Rs. 271.87 crore to total 2119 women beneficiaries during last five years (FY 2020-21 to FY2024-25) under PMMSY. This include an amount of Rs 7.35 crore sanctioned and release of Rs 4.48 crore to a total 32 women beneficiaries in Palghar District
